Bettye’s Obituary Bettye Lou Killham, 86, of North Platte joined her heavenly father and awaiting loved ones on January 24, 2019. Bettye was born in Alleene, Arkansas to Eugene and Buelah Scarborough on February 27, 1932. At the age 15 she moved to Pacifica, California.

There she married Robert L. Killham and to this union came a daughter, Karen and a son, Ricky. Bettye had a successful career with AT&T and retired after 30+ years. In 2010 Bettye settled in Nebraska to be with her grandchildren.

Bettye was a woman of faith and had a strong relationship with God. She enjoyed dancing, cooking, reading, watching old movies and spending time with her family. Her positive way of thinking, good sense of humor, contagious smile and wise words will be missed greatly.

Bettye is preceded in death by her parents, Eugene and Buelah, son Ricky Lee, sisters Marle Zarnock and Rachel Reed, brothers Calvin and Kelsey Scarborough, (ex) husband Robert Killham, and father and mother in-law Guy and Ellen Killham. She leaves behind her daughter and best friend, Karen of North Platte, A sister, Lena Brooks of AZ, granddaughters Lori (Brent) Luft, Jessica (Scott) Hernandez, Ricci (Dana) Foster, Faith (Zach) Killham, 16 great grandchildren all of North Platte and nieces and nephews. A private service will be held at a later date.
